Abstract

Vignetting correction is an essential process of image signal processing. It is an important part for obtaining high-quality images, but the research in this field has not been fully emphasized. The mainstream methods are based on calibration which processes are complex. And many methods get low accuracy and poor robustness in practical. In this paper, we analyzed the optical principle of vignetting and its influence on the image. Then, we proposed an algorithm based on color-intensity map entropy optimization to correct image vignetting. Moreover, because of the lack of dataset of vignetting, we proposed a method for constructing vignetting image dataset through capturing the real scenes. Compared with the dataset generated through simulation, our dataset is more authentic and reliable. Many experiments have been carried out on this dataset, and the results proved that the proposed algorithm achieved the best performance.
